    Rotary Limit Switches Market Summary

    As per MRFR analysis, the Rotary Limit Switches Market was estimated at 1.064 USD Billion in 2024. The Rotary Limit Switches industry is projected to grow from 1.116 USD Billion in 2025 to 1.81 USD Billion by 2035, exhibiting a compound annual growth rate (CAGR) of 4.95 during the forecast period 2025 - 2035.

    Expansion of Industrial Applications

    The Rotary Limit Switches Market is experiencing growth due to the expansion of industrial applications. Industries such as oil and gas, mining, and manufacturing increasingly rely on rotary limit switches for their operational needs. These switches are essential for controlling the position of machinery and ensuring safety in hazardous environments. The oil and gas sector, for instance, has seen a significant increase in the use of rotary limit switches to monitor drilling equipment and pipeline operations. Market data indicates that the industrial sector is expected to witness a steady growth rate, which may lead to a heightened demand for rotary limit switches. This trend suggests that manufacturers must innovate and adapt their products to meet the specific requirements of diverse industrial applications.

    By Type: Mechanical Limit Switches (Largest) vs. Electronic Limit Switches (Fastest-Growing)

    In the Rotary Limit Switches Market, Mechanical Limit Switches currently hold the largest share among the various types available. These switches are favored for their proven reliability and performance in numerous applications, particularly in industrial settings. Their robust construction and ability to operate in harsh environments contribute to their widespread adoption. Meanwhile, Electronic Limit Switches are gaining traction due to their advanced features and capabilities. They combine precision with flexibility, making them suitable for modern automation solutions that demand greater efficiency and control.

    Mechanical Limit Switches (Dominant) vs. Electronic Limit Switches (Emerging)

    Mechanical Limit Switches continue to dominate the Rotary Limit Switches Market, primarily due to their durability and simplicity in design. They are often preferred in high-cycle applications where consistent performance is essential. Conversely, Electronic Limit Switches represent an emerging trend, offering digital functionalities that cater to contemporary automation needs. Companies are leaning towards these electronic variants due to their ability to provide accurate feedback and adaptable programming. As industries evolve, the demand for precision in control systems pushes electronic options to gain momentum, reflecting a shift in market preferences.

    Regional Insights

    North America : Technological Innovation Leader

    The North American rotary limit switches market is driven by technological advancements and increasing automation across industries. The region holds the largest market share at approximately 40%, with the U.S. being the primary contributor due to its strong manufacturing base and investment in smart technologies. Regulatory support for automation and safety standards further fuels demand, making it a key player in the global market. Leading countries in this region include the United States and Canada, with major players like Honeywell, Rockwell Automation, and Eaton dominating the landscape. The competitive environment is characterized by continuous innovation and strategic partnerships among key players, enhancing product offerings and market reach. The presence of advanced manufacturing facilities and a skilled workforce further strengthens the market position in North America.

    Europe : Regulatory Framework Support

    Europe is witnessing significant growth in the rotary limit switches market, driven by stringent safety regulations and a push for automation in various sectors. The region holds the second-largest market share at around 30%. Countries like Germany and France are at the forefront, with robust industrial sectors and a focus on energy efficiency, which are key drivers for market expansion. Regulatory frameworks such as the Machinery Directive promote the adoption of advanced technologies, enhancing market potential. Germany, France, and the UK are leading countries in this market, with key players like Siemens, Schneider Electric, and Marquardt. The competitive landscape is marked by innovation and collaboration among manufacturers to meet evolving customer needs. The presence of established companies and a strong emphasis on R&D contribute to the region's dynamic market environment, positioning Europe as a significant player in The Rotary Limit Switches.

    Industry Developments

    • Q2 2024: SICK AG launches new rotary limit switch for industrial automation applications SICK AG announced the launch of its latest rotary limit switch designed for enhanced precision and durability in industrial automation, targeting applications in material handling and crane systems.
    • Q1 2024: Schneider Electric introduces Telemecanique Sensors rotary limit switch for wind energy sector Schneider Electric unveiled a new rotary limit switch under its Telemecanique Sensors brand, specifically engineered for use in wind turbine pitch and yaw control systems.
    • Q2 2024: Bernstein AG expands production facility for rotary limit switches in Germany Bernstein AG announced the opening of a new production line at its Porta Westfalica facility to meet growing demand for rotary limit switches in European and global markets.
    • Q3 2024: Stromag (Altra Industrial Motion) launches new P-8500 rotary limit switch for heavy-duty cranes Stromag, a brand of Altra Industrial Motion, introduced the P-8500 rotary limit switch, designed for high-load crane and hoist applications, featuring improved safety and reliability.
    • Q2 2025: Giovenzana International B.V. announces partnership with Siemens for smart rotary limit switch integration Giovenzana International B.V. entered a partnership with Siemens to integrate smart rotary limit switches into Siemens' industrial automation platforms, enhancing connectivity and diagnostics.
    • Q1 2025: MecVel Srl unveils compact rotary limit switch for electric actuators MecVel Srl launched a new compact rotary limit switch model tailored for integration with electric linear actuators, targeting the automation and renewable energy sectors.
    • Q2 2024: Wachendorff Automation introduces modular rotary limit switch system Wachendorff Automation announced the release of a modular rotary limit switch system, allowing for customizable configurations to suit diverse industrial applications.
    • Q3 2024: AMETEK Factory Automation secures contract to supply rotary limit switches for Middle East port cranes AMETEK Factory Automation won a contract to provide rotary limit switches for a major port crane modernization project in the Middle East, supporting enhanced safety and automation.
    • Q4 2024: Elcis Encoder Srl launches high-precision rotary limit switch for stage technology Elcis Encoder Srl introduced a high-precision rotary limit switch designed for use in stage technology and theater automation, offering improved position accuracy and reliability.
    • Q1 2025: Soldo Controls (Emerson) debuts explosion-proof rotary limit switch for hazardous environments Soldo Controls, part of Emerson, launched an explosion-proof rotary limit switch certified for use in hazardous industrial environments such as oil & gas and chemical processing.
